Tackling the Legality of Cannabis Across America

The landscape of cannabis legality in the United States is a dynamic and evolving one. While some states have embraced recreational and medicinal use, others remain strict. This mosaic legal framework creates headaches for both individuals and businesses existing in the cannabis industry. Navigating the specific laws in each jurisdiction is essential to avoid judicial repercussions.

A key aspect of this terrain involves differentiating between recreational and medicinal use, as regulations often differ significantly. Furthermore, the federal government's stance on cannabis remains a origin of confusion. While federal law still classifies cannabis as a Schedule I drug, recent trends have signaled a potential for reform. This ongoing struggle between state and federal laws highlights the need for continued advocacy and involvement in shaping the future of cannabis policy.

From Prohibition to Progress: Cannabis in Modern America

The history of cannabis marijuana in America is a complex and fascinating one, marked by periods of both prohibition and progress. For decades, it was demonized as a dangerous drug, leading to criminalization and social stigma. However, the winds of change shifted blowing in the late 20th century, with growing public support for reform. This shift culminated in recent years with several states implementing their own cannabis legalization laws, creating a patchwork of regulations across the country. The discussion surrounding cannabis continues to rage on, with proponents highlighting its medical benefits more info and economic potential, while opponents raise concerns about its potential for abuse and societal impact.

Despite the ongoing debate, there's no denying that the landscape of cannabis in America is rapidly evolving. From the black market to burgeoning legal markets, the industry is attracting significant investment and generating new jobs. The future of cannabis in America remains uncertain, but one thing is clear: it's a topic which will continue to shape public policy and societal norms for years to come.
